Settled driveways and cracked walkways are a familiar problem for homeowners in Hull, and the Piedmont red clay beneath Madison County is the reason. This part of northeast Georgia sits on weathered crystalline bedrock that produces a heavy, moisture-sensitive clay mixed with sandy loam deposits. The clay swells as it soaks up rain and contracts when it dries, gradually opening voids beneath concrete. Rolling terrain and creek corridors in the area channel storm runoff toward low-lying foundations, concentrating the moisture that drives settlement.

Hull is a small community between Athens and Danielsville with a housing stock that includes older homes near the town center and properties on surrounding agricultural land. Because much of this area was farmed before it was built on, some foundations rest on soil that was loosened by decades of cultivation but never compacted for residential loads. Northeast Georgia receives 48 to 52 inches of rain annually, with the wettest months running from late winter through spring. Winter lows in the 20s and 30s add freeze-thaw stress that widens cracks the clay has already produced.
Concrete leveling in Hull runs $5 to $20 per square foot for polyurethane foam injection, putting most residential projects between $500 and $2,200. Mudjacking is also an option for larger surfaces. Full slab replacement averages $3,000 to $6,500 in Madison County, so leveling saves you a significant amount while getting the job done in a single day. Match the service to your slab
Dri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ors each have different load and drainage requirements. Make sure the contractor you contact has experience with your specific slab type.
Ask about the leveling method
Mudjacking and foam leveling are the two main approaches. Foam is lighter and cures in about 15 minutes; mudjacking costs less upfront. Ask each contractor which method they use and why it fits your situation.

Compare warranties side by side
Warranty length and terms vary. A longer warranty is valuable, but read what it actually covers. Some warranties exclude certain soil conditions or only apply to the original homeowner.
